US coronavirus: FDA authorizes first fully at-home test as more Covid-19 patients are hospitalized than ever before

FDA authorizes first fully at-home test by Ellume as more Covid-19 patients are hospitalized than ever before CNN 12/16/2020 By Holly Yan, Steve Almasy and Christina Maxouris, CNN © Jessica Rinaldi/Pool/The Boston Globe/AP Richard Guarino, Boston Medical Center Supply Chain Operations Associate Director, delivers a box of Pfizer-BioNTech COVID-19 vaccines to the pharmacy at Boston Medical Center, Monday, Dec. 14, 2020. (Jessica Rinaldi/The Boston Globe via AP, Pool) After a day of celebration and heartache, Americans face a harsh reality with the Covid-19 crisis. A record 112,816 Covid-19 patients were hospitalized Tuesday, according to the Covid Tracking Project. That will inevitably lead to more deaths as Christmas and New Year s Day get closer.

NYC Restaurants in Dire Situation With Indoor Ban and Snow Closing Outdoor Dining

NYC Restaurants in Dire Situation With Indoor Ban and Snow Closing Outdoor Dining Newsweek 15/12/2020 Jon Jackson © Spencer Platt/Getty Governor Andrew Cuomo of New York suggested on Monday that he collaborate with Dr. Anthony Fauci on an advertisement touting the coronavirus vaccine. New York Governor Andrew Cuomo already knew that the timing was bad to bar indoor dining in New York City again beginning on Monday, to prevent the continuing spread of COVID-19. The two-week closure leaves restaurant owners struggling to afford to keep their businesses open while workers face losing their jobs, all during the holiday season. What Cuomo couldn t have predicted was what meteorologists believe will be a major winter storm on Wednesday night and Thursday morning, one that could dump a foot or more of snow onto the city. That forecast resulted in the city issuing an active snow alert Monday evening that suspends outdoor dining starting on Wednesday.

New York coronavirus: Last night of indoor dining before ban comes in today

comments New Yorkers headed out for a final night of indoor dining on Sunday before a ban comes into force today   Governor Cuomo announced ban amid soaring coronavirus cases and hospital admissions across New York Cuomo hopes the ban will avoid a city-wide shut-down of all non-essential shops in the run-up to Christmas But restaurateurs warn it will be a hammer-blow for their businesses, with more than half facing closure  New Yorkers headed out for a final night of indoor dining on Sunday before a ban comes into force today amid rising coronavirus cases across the city. Andrew Cuomo announced the ban last week as the city s ICU departments headed for 90 per cent capacity, flooded with critically ill coronavirus patients that left resources stretched to the maximum.
